The Role of Chance and Probability in Plinko

Unlike games requiring skill, plinko is almost entirely dictated by chance. Each drop of the puck represents an independent event, meaning that past results have absolutely no influence on future outcomes. Consequently, statistical analysis can offer some insights into the long-term expected return of the game, but it cannot predict individual results. This reinforces the game’s fundamental premise – it’s a game of pure luck. Players should embrace this randomness and view it as entertainment, rather than a reliable source of income.

The probabilities associated with landing in different prize slots are determined by the board’s design and layout. As mentioned earlier, more pegs tend to result in a more even distribution of outcomes, while fewer pegs can introduce some level of predictability. However, even with a seemingly predictable board, the inherent randomness of the puck’s descent ensures that outcomes are never entirely certain. Understanding these probabilities is important for setting realistic expectations and managing your bankroll.

This is further illustrated through the concept of the ‘house edge’. Like most casino games, plinko has a built-in house edge, which represents the casino’s average profit over the long run. This edge stems from the payout structure being slightly less than the true statistical expected value of the game. While players may experience winning streaks, the house edge ensures that the casino will eventually come out ahead. It’s a crucial concept for any player to understand before engaging with plinko or any other casino game.

Managing Your Bankroll While Playing Plinko

Effective bankroll management is paramount when playing any casino game, and plinko is no exception. Given its reliance on chance, it’s especially important to approach the game with a pre-defined budget and stick to it rigorously.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ly deplete your funds. Instead, consider setting win limits – targets that, when reached, signal it’s time to cash out and enjoy your profits. Disciplined bankroll management transforms plinko from a potentially risky endeavor into a form of affordable entertainment.

A sensible str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units, betting only a small percentage on each drop. This extends your playtime and gives you more opportunities to experience the game’s ups and downs. Furthermore, consider setting a loss limit – the maximum amount you’re willing to lose in a single session. Once this limit is reached, stop playing and walk away. Remember, the goal is to have fun and enjoy the game, not to recoup losses at all costs. Responsible gaming practices are essential for protecting your financial well-being.

  • Set a budget before you start playing.
  • Divide your bankroll into smaller units.
  • Bet only a small percentage of your bankroll per drop.
  • Set win limits and cash out when you reach them.
  • Set loss limits and stop playing when you reach them.
